- 1、本文档共32页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
iOS控件的个性化定制技术与应用
iOS控件概念、类型与开发意义
个性化定制技术关键点与分类
控件外观定制与实现方案
控件功能定制与实现方案
控件交互定制与实现方案
自定义控件开放性方案
控件定制技术在典型商业应用场景分析
控件定制技术应用中高效实现方法ContentsPage目录页
iOS控件概念、类型与开发意义iOS控件的个性化定制技术与应用
iOS控件概念、类型与开发意义iOS控件的概念1.iOS控件是用户和应用程序交互的基本元素,它们允许应用程序提供交互式界面,用户可以通过控件控制和修改应用程序的行为。2.iOS控件包括各种各样的元素,如按钮、文本框、开关、滑块、进度条、分段控件、表视图、集合视图、导航栏、工具栏等。3.iOS控件可以动态创建和销毁,并可以根据用户交互或应用程序状态的变化进行更新。iOS控件的类型1.iOS控件可以分为两大类:系统控件和自定义控件。系统控件是苹果公司提供的标准控件,通常与iOS的系统风格保持一致,而自定义控件是开发者自己创建的控件,可以实现更加个性化的外观和行为。2.iOS控件还根据其用途和功能进一步细分为多种类型,如按钮控件、文本控件、图像控件、容器控件、导航控件、分割控件等。3.每种类型的控件都具有不同的属性和方法,应用程序可以通过设置控件的属性和调用控件的方法来控制控件的外观和行为。
iOS控件概念、类型与开发意义iOS控件的开发意义1.iOS控件是开发iOS应用程序的基础元素,通过使用控件,开发者可以轻松地创建具有交互性的应用程序界面,提高应用程序的易用性和用户体验。2.iOS控件可以帮助开发者快速构建应用程序,减少开发时间和成本,同时提高应用程序的可移植性,使应用程序可以在不同的iOS设备上运行。3.iOS控件为开发者提供了丰富的定制选项,使其能够根据应用程序的需求和用户的偏好调整控件的外观和行为,创建个性化和美观的应用程序界面。
个性化定制技术关键点与分类iOS控件的个性化定制技术与应用
个性化定制技术关键点与分类组件化封装技术:1.提供了独立的开发和维护环境,简化了代码管理和维护工作。2.支持组件的复用和共享,提高开发效率和代码质量。3.允许组件之间进行灵活组合和集成,便于构建复杂的应用。数据持久化技术:1.采用CoreData框架作为数据存储解决方案,提供对象-关系映射(ORM)功能,简化数据操作。2.利用SQLite数据库作为底层存储引擎,确保数据安全性和完整性。3.提供数据加密和访问控制机制,保护敏感数据。
个性化定制技术关键点与分类图形渲染技术:1.利用OpenGLES框架进行图形渲染,提供强大的3D图形处理能力。2.使用Metal框架进行图形编程,充分利用GPU资源,实现高效的图形渲染。3.采用SwiftUI框架进行图形界面设计,提供简洁、现代的界面元素。手势识别技术:1.利用UIKit中的UIGestureRecognizer类进行手势识别,支持多种常见手势,如点击、拖动、捏合等。2.使用CoreMotion框架进行设备运动检测,支持设备摇晃、倾斜等动作识别。3.提供自定义手势识别功能,允许开发者根据特定需求创建自定义手势。
个性化定制技术关键点与分类网络通信技术:1.利用URLSession框架进行网络请求,支持HTTP和HTTPS协议,允许开发者轻松发送和接收数据。2.采用Socket编程进行网络通信,提供更底层的网络连接控制,适用于需要自定义网络协议的场景。3.使用Alamofire或AFNetworking等第三方库进行网络请求,简化网络操作并提供丰富的功能。异步编程技术:1.利用GrandCentralDispatch(GCD)进行异步编程,支持并发任务执行,提高应用性能。2.使用OperationQueue进行异步任务管理,简化并发任务的创建和管理。3.采用SwiftConcurrency框架进行并发编程,提供现代化的异步编程方式,包括async/await、actor等。
控件外观定制与实现方案iOS控件的个性化定制技术与应用
控件外观定制与实现方案控件外观定制的必要性1.控件外观定制可以满足不同用户对界面风格和视觉效果的个性化需求,提升用户体验。2.控件外观定制可以帮助开发者打造出具有独特风格和品牌特色的应用,增强应用的辨识度和竞争力。3.控件外观定制可以促进开发者创新,推动控件设计和开发技术的进步。控件外观定制的可行性1.iOS系统提供了丰富的控件定制接口和工具,支持开发者对控件的外观进行定制。2.第三方控件库和框架也提供了大量可定制的控件,开发者可以根据需要选择和使用。3.开发者可以借助编程语言和设计工具,自行设计和实现控件的外观
文档评论(0)